I would like to present you a very practical skill which can make your work and private life a bit more exciting. It should be primarily useful for people who deal with others during face to face meetings, presentations, conferences, etc. It is fairly easy to learn and it is based on flexible attention.

Flexible attention is the ability to alternate between narrow attention style (focused) and diffused attention style (broad) or to apply both at the same time. Narrowing makes us specific but requires dividing reality into smaller pieces (objects). Diffusing allows us to see the big picture and connect (immerse) with its elements.

For example, you can read and understand this text (narrow attention style) while staying aware of something more (diffused attention style). Try the exercise below to experience what flexible attention feels like.
